Difficult seasons are part of every life. Trying to avoid them only increases frustration and fear. Real strength is not found in escape—it’s found in adaptation.

This episode explores how emotional resilience grows when you learn to stay grounded in the middle of uncertainty. When you shift from resistance to response, clarity sharpens, steadiness returns, and a true daily reset becomes possible. You may not control the weather, but you can control how you move within it.

Pause for a few minutes, breathe slowly, and let this moment remind you that resilience is not the absence of struggle. It is the decision to remain steady through it.

resilience through mindfulness. Enjoy. Emotional resilience is the ability to adapt to stress

0:33.8

and adversity while maintaining a stable mental outlook. It's about bouncing back

0:38.7

from difficult experiences and emerging stronger. Developing emotional resilience isn't

0:44.1

about avoiding difficulties, but learning how to cope with them effectively. Understanding

0:49.4

emotional resilience begins with recognizing that life is filled with challenges. Whether it's a major life

0:55.4

event or daily stressors, these experiences test your emotional strength. The good news is that

1:01.5

resilience is not a trait you're born with. It's a skill that can be developed. By focusing on your

1:07.5

mindset and behaviors, you can build the foundation for greater emotional

1:11.5

resilience.

1:13.5

Mindfulness plays a crucial role in building emotional resilience.

1:17.0

By being fully present and aware of your thoughts and feelings without judgment, you

1:20.7

create a space to respond thoughtfully rather than react impulsively.

1:25.4

This practice helps you to understand your emotions better and manage them more

1:28.8

effectively. When you incorporate mindfulness into your daily routine, you learn to observe your

1:34.1

experiences from a distance, which can reduce the intensity of negative emotions. Over time, this

1:40.2

leads to a more balanced emotional state, enhancing your ability to cope with stress and adversity.
